The Department of Women's and Gender Studies at Loyola Marymount University invites applications for an Instructor position to begin Fall 2026. This is a non-tenure track faculty appointment with an initial appointment term of up to 1 year. Continuation beyond the initial term, if any, will be determined based on institutional needs and applicable review processes. This full-time, 9‑month academic appointment (August – May) has an annual salary paid over 12 consecutive months, allowing for continuous benefits coverage.

We seek candidates with demonstrated potential for teaching excellence to teach introductory courses in Women's and Gender Studies and upper division courses that contribute to the curriculum, in consultation with the chair. This is a full-time, non-tenure track, teaching position (3‑3 base teaching load). PhD in WGST or cognate fields preferred.

The Department places a high priority on diverse perspectives, social justice, and inclusive pedagogy in fostering academic excellence. Candidates must show promise in both research and teaching.
